Two candidates have been selected to move on to the next step to determine who will be our next county commissioner. Harry "Duke" Dunn and Terry London both gave presentations to the board about who they were and their past experience. The commissioners heard first from Dunn who has served on the Marysville city council for the past twelve years. Terry London, the second candidate, also gave a presentation to the board. The former county commissioner previously served three terms on the board off and on, and spent time as a state lawmaker in Lansing. Both candiates have also previously served in the armed forces. Next Thursday, before the commissioners committee meeting, they will bring the candidates in for a formal interview process and after the meeting they will make their final decision. The county seat being filled represent the 4th district, which includes much of Port Huron Twp. and Marysville.
